How they compare
Ireland currently reports 0.0432 current LCU per US$ of GDP against 0.035 current LCU per US$ of GDP in United States, a difference of 0.0082 current LCU per US$ of GDP.
That makes Ireland's figure about 1.2 times United States's.
Across all 25 years both countries report, Ireland has been ahead every year.
Ireland ranks 178th and United States ranks 181st of 197 countries.
Ireland has averaged higher in every one of the 4 decades both report.

About this data
Taxes less subsidies on products (current LCU) divided by GDP (current US$), matched on country and year. Neither publisher issues this ratio as a series; it is computed here from both.
